[U-Boot] [PATCH v2] board/t4240rdb: VID support

From: Ying Zhang b40530@freescale.com
The fuse status register provides the values from on-chip voltage ID efuses programmed at the factory. These values define the voltage requirements for the chip. u-boot reads FUSESR and translates the values into the appropriate commands to set the voltage output value of an external voltage regulator.
